The question

Is it permissible for the Imam to pray behind a wall that separates the men's prayer hall from the women's prayer hall?

The answer

The questioner did not mention an excuse that would make it permissible for the women's prayer area to be in front of the men. It has been previously ruled that it is permissible for women to pray in a separate room in front of the Imam if there is an excuse, such as the impossibility of placing the women's prayer area behind the Imam. Praying in a separate place is permissible out of necessity, and this is the choice of some scholars, while others believe that following the Imam in these cases is not valid. It is more cautious for women not to pray in front of the Imam in a separate room, especially since they are not obligated to pray in the mosque in the first place, so they should not risk praying in a manner over which there is a difference of opinion regarding its validity.
